Where is the Hoppler family from?

You can see how Hoppler families moved over time by selecting different census years. The Hoppler family name was found in the USA, the UK, and Canada between 1880 and 1920. The most Hoppler families were found in USA in 1920. In 1891 there was 1 Hoppler family living in Yorkshire. This was 100% of all the recorded Hoppler's in United Kingdom. Yorkshire had the highest population of Hoppler families in 1891.

What did your Hoppler ancestors do for a living?

In 1940, Farmer and Clerk were the top reported jobs for men and women in the USA named Hoppler. 47% of Hoppler men worked as a Farmer and 100% of Hoppler women worked as a Clerk.

What is the average Hoppler lifespan?

Between 1960 and 2000, in the United States, Hoppler life expectancy was at its lowest point in 1985, and highest in 1990. The average life expectancy for Hoppler in 1960 was 65, and 73 in 2000.

An unusually short lifespan might indicate that your Hoppler ancestors lived in harsh conditions. A short lifespan might also indicate health problems that were once prevalent in your family.
